About Ian C. Hsu
Ian C. Hsu is a scholar working on Instrumentation, Biophysics and Family Practice, having authored 57 papers that have together received 795 indexed citations. Recurring topics across this work include 3D IC and TSV technologies (8 papers), Particle accelerators and beam dynamics (7 papers) and Electronic Packaging and Soldering Technologies (7 papers). The work is most often cited by research in Biophysics (67 citations), Physiology (20 citations) and Molecular Biology (299 citations). Ian C. Hsu has collaborated with scholars based in Taiwan, United States and Australia. Frequent co-authors include Wun‐Yi Shu, Min‐Lung Tsai, Cheng-Wei Chang, Wei‐Chung Cheng, Chia‐Yang Li, Chi‐Shiun Chiang, Yujia Cui, Chien‐Ming Wu, Chi‐Shuo Chen and Wei‐Chun Chin. Their work appears in journals such as Journal of Biological Chemistry, PLoS ONE and The Science of The Total Environment.
